Three held for killing ox in Gulmi



KATHMANDU: Police have arrested three people on the charge of killing an ox in Malika rural municipality-2 in Gulmi district.

Acting on a tip-off, a police squad arrested 19-year-old Lokendra Bohara, and two other minors whose names have been kept confidential.

According to District Police Office Gulmi, the trio killed an ox by striking it with a hammer on May 30.

Police said they are investigating the case.
